About Hanna's Cafe
Hanna's Cafe is an independent café located within Melbourne Airport in Victoria, Australia, serving travellers and airport staff. They specialise in espresso-based coffees, teas, cold drinks, and a range of breakfast and brunch-style meals, including pastries, hot breakfasts, salads, sandwiches, and other light café fare. As an airport café, they typically operate in line with flight schedules, catering to early-morning and late-evening travellers, and accept common card payment methods used by both domestic and international visitors.
A charge from “HANNA'S CAFE,” “HANNAS CAFE MELB AIRPORT,” or a similar description on your bank or card statement usually relates to an in-person purchase made at the café, such as coffee, food, or takeaway items. The amount might reflect a single purchase, multiple items rung up together, or a bill you paid for a group. In some cases, you might see a small pending authorization if your card was pre-authorized when opening a tab or if the terminal briefly checked your card; this typically adjusts to the final purchase amount once the transaction is completed.
If you’re unsure about a Hanna's Cafe charge, start by checking any receipts or email confirmations from the date of the transaction, as well as your travel itinerary for when you were at Melbourne Airport. Compare the transaction date, time, and amount with your boarding time, lounge access, or waiting periods at the terminal. To resolve questions, you can contact the café via the contact details or form provided on hannascafe.com.au or enquire through Melbourne Airport’s general information channels, providing the exact transaction date, amount, and the last four digits of your card. For suspected errors or duplicate charges, speak with the café first; if the issue isn’t resolved, contact your bank or card issuer to dispute the transaction.
